如何创建安全、高效的区块链钱包平台:全面指

        时间:2025-06-28 06:39:32

        主页 > 资讯问题 >

            
                

            随着区块链技术的不断发展,越来越多的人开始关注区块链钱包的创建和开发。区块链钱包作为数字资产管理的重要工具,其市场需求正在迅速增长。然而,在创建一个区块链钱包平台时,除了具备基本的技术知识,开发者还需考虑安全性、用户体验、合规性以及平台的可扩展性。本文将详细介绍如何创建一个区块链钱包平台,包括必要的步骤和注意事项,同时还将解答一些常见问题。

            第一步:市场调研与需求分析

            在着手开发区块链钱包平台之前,首先需要进行市场调研与需求分析。这一环节至关重要,因为它将帮助开发者了解目标用户的需求、市场竞争情况以及潜在的盈利模式。

            市场调研可以通过问卷调查、在线访谈、社交媒体分析等方式进行。了解用户对钱包功能、安全性、用户界面及使用体验等方面的需求,可以帮助开发团队明确产品定位。此外,竞争对手的分析也非常重要。调查现有钱包平台的优劣势,能够为自身开发提供有价值的参考。

            需求分析完成后,可以根据用户的反馈调整产品功能,例如支持多种加密货币、便捷的兑换功能、高级安全防护等。经过这一阶段的调研与分析,团队将拥有一个清晰的产品概念和市场定位。

            第二步:技术选型与架构设计

            如何创建安全、高效的区块链钱包平台:全面指南

            确定了钱包平台的功能和市场定位之后,接下来就是技术选型与架构设计。这一阶段需要考虑如何将技术与业务需求相结合,确保平台性能、安全及用户体验。

            对于区块链钱包开发,通常需要选择合适的区块链网络,如以太坊、比特币等。同时,还需选择适合的编程语言和开发框架。例如,Node.js、Python、Java等都是常用的后端语言,而 React.js、Vue.js 等可以用于前端开发。

            此外,系统架构设计也非常关键。需要考虑如何确保钱包平台的可扩展性和灵活性。架构设计可以采用微服务架构,以便在日后需要添加新功能时更为方便。 数据库的选择(如MySQL、MongoDB)也要服务于高并发、高可用性的需求。

            第三步:安全设计与防护措施

            安全性是区块链钱包平台最重要的因素之一。开发团队必须考虑如何保护用户的个人信息和数字资产安全,避免黑客攻击和数据泄露等问题。

            在安全设计时,可以采取多重身份验证(如短信验证、邮箱验证等)、加密存储用户私钥、定期审计系统漏洞等。使用安全的网络协议(如HTTPS)进行数据传输也是非常重要的一环。

            开发者还需关注智能合约的安全性,确保合约代码的无漏洞性。此外,建议引入第三方安全审计公司来审核钱包的安全性,以获得用户的信任。

            第四步:用户体验与界面设计

            如何创建安全、高效的区块链钱包平台:全面指南

            顶尖的钱包平台往往拥有友好的用户界面与良好的用户体验。因此,界面设计不可忽视。在设计钱包界面时,要确保操作的简洁性和易用性,让用户能够方便地进行交易、查看余额、管理资金等操作。

            可以通过原型设计工具(如Figma、Sketch)制作用户界面原型,并进行用户测试,以获得反馈。根据用户反馈进行,使得界面更加符合用户习惯。同时,可以提供丰富的用户帮助文档和客服支持,增强用户的信任感与满意度。

            第五步:合规性问题与法律风险

            区块链技术的法律和合规性问题是开发钱包平台的重要考虑因素,在不同国家和地区对数字货币的法律法规存在较大差异。因此,开发团队需要了解并遵守相关法律法规,确保钱包平台的合规性。

            这是一个较为复杂的话题,各国对于加密货币、数据保护及反洗钱的立法不尽相同。开发团队可以咨询专业的法律顾问,确保平台的运营框架符合当地法律要求。同时,要做好用户身份验证,实施反洗钱机制,以应对合规性挑战。

            常见问题解答

            问题 1:我应该选择哪种类型的钱包?

            区块链钱包主要分为热钱包和冷钱包。热钱包连接到互联网,便于操作,适用于频繁交易;而冷钱包则是脱机存储,更适合长期保管资产,安全性较高。选择哪种类型的钱包需要根据个人的需求而定。如果你是一个交易频繁的投资者,热钱包可能更适合你;如果你打算长期持有资产,冷钱包将是更安全的选择。

            问题 2:如何确保我的区块链钱包安全?

            确保区块链钱包安全的关键在于采取多重安全措施。首先,使用强密码并定期更换。其次,启用双因素身份验证来增加安全性。对于冷钱包用户,建议将私钥离线存储,避免数字攻击。此外,定期检查钱包的安全设置与系统更新,保持对最新安全漏洞的关注。

            问题 3:如何恢复丢失的区块链钱包?

            区块链钱包的恢复通常依赖于助记词或私钥。如果你在创建钱包时保存了助记词,可以通过输入助记词在支持的应用中恢复钱包。对于没有助记词或私钥的情况,恢复钱包的可能性会大大降低,因此,在创建钱包时务必妥善保存备份信息,避免资产损失。

            问题 4:如何扩大我的区块链钱包平台的用户基础?

            扩大区块链钱包平台用户基础的有效策略包括提升用户体验、进行市场营销和建立合作关系。可以通过社交媒体、社区和论坛宣传钱包的优势,吸引用户注册和使用。同时,提供用户激励措施(如手续费减免、推荐奖励等)来吸引新用户。此外,与其他行业(如电商、金融机构等)进行合作,拓宽用户来源,增加钱包的使用场景。

            综上所述,创建一个区块链钱包平台涉及多方面的考虑。从市场调研、技术选型到安全设计与用户体验,每一步都需要认真对待与细致规划。随着区块链技术的发展,钱包平台的需求也将不断增长,开发者把握这一机遇,将会迎来更多的挑战与机遇。